ANNOUNCEMENT OF SUCCESSFUL APPLICANTS FOR THE 2025 PRESIDENTIAL EMPLOYMENT STIMULUS PROGRAMME (PESP 6)

The National Arts Council of South Africa (NAC) is pleased to announce the list of successfulapplicants who responded to the 2025 Presidential Employment Stimulus Programme (PESP6) callfor funding across seven (7) arts disciplines namely: Music, Literature, Visual Arts, Crafts, Theatre,Dance and Multidiscipline. The Call opened on 16 September 2025 and closed on 09 October 2025. […]

NAC CLARIFIES REASONS FOR 2025 ANNUAL PROJECT FUNDING OUTCOMES DELAY AND ANNOUNCES STAGGERED OUTCOME RELEASE PLAN

 Media Statement: For immediate release 17 October 2025  The National Arts Council of South Africa (NAC) wishes to clarify the reasons behind the postponement of the 2025 Annual Project Funding outcomes, as announced on 16 October 2025.  The NAC received a total of 3,763 applications for the annual project funding call across various disciplines. 2,278 […]
